1 June-4 September. The ongoing legacy of Brussels-based architectural practice 51N4E is highlighted in a retrospective exhibition presented by BOZAR Centre for Fine Arts.

Curated by the French architectural expert Dominique Boudet, the buildings designed by 51N4E are critically evaluated from a philosophical point of view, from the firm's earliest designs to its recent projects, both in Belgium and abroad. The exhibition coincides with the launch of a book about the firm's buildings, with accompanying texts by architects and critics.
